Our Process What Hiring This Cincinnati Painting Company Feels Like

1. Reach Out

Call, text, or send the form with the property and the scope you're planning.

2. On-site Estimate

An estimator meets you at the building, walks the job, and provides a written, free estimate.

3. Schedule Around You

Dates are set around your operations and tenants — no deposit to hold the calendar.

4. The Work

Crews prep, protect, and coat to commercial standards, keeping you posted as the project moves.

5. PM Walkthrough

A project manager inspects the finished work and walks it with you before final payment.

6. The Warranty

Every project carries a 2-year warranty on labor and materials.
